Embodiment 1

[0026] A probiotic for regulating the intestinal flora of astronauts, including the following components in mass fraction: lentinan 23.7%, walnut powder 12.4%, jujube powder 13.9%, lily powder 11.9%, bifidobacterium 14.1%, cheese Lactobacillus 12.5% ​​and Lactobacillus rhamnosus 11.5%.

Embodiment 2

[0028] A probiotic for regulating the intestinal flora of astronauts, including the following components in mass fraction: lentinan 20%, walnut powder 10%, jujube powder 20%, lily powder 10%, bifidobacterium 10%, cheese Lactobacillus 10% and Lactobacillus rhamnosus 10%.

Embodiment 3

[0030] A probiotic for regulating the intestinal flora of astronauts, including the following components in mass fraction: lentinan 30%, walnut powder 10%, jujube powder 10%, lily powder 20%, bifidobacteria 10%, cheese Lactobacillus 10% and Lactobacillus rhamnosus 10%.

Abstract

The invention discloses probiotics for regulating intestinal flora of astronauts. The probiotics comprise the following components in percentage by mass: 30-45% of intestinal probiotics, 20-30% of lentinan, 10-20% of walnut powder, 10-20% of jujube powder and 10-20% of lily powder. The preparation process comprises the following steps: weighing the raw materials in parts by weight, mixing the walnut powder, the Chinese date powder and the lily powder, adding water, extracting for 8-10 hours, and filtering to obtain an extracting solution; concentrating and crushing the extract liquor to obtain mixed powder; adding lentinan, bifidobacterium, lactobacillus casei and lactobacillus rhamnosus into the mixed powder, and uniformly mixing to obtain a finished product. The food can effectively regulate the balance of intestinal flora of astronauts in a weightlessness state and enhance the immunity.

technical field [0001] The invention relates to the technical field of health care products, and more specifically relates to a probiotic for regulating the intestinal flora of astronauts, a preparation method and application thereof. Background technique [0002] During spaceflight, people are in special environments such as weightlessness, radiation, noise, and small and confined spaces. Due to the redistribution of body fluids, the function of the spleen and stomach is reduced. Astronauts will experience muscle atrophy, bone calcium loss, intestinal flora disorder, Weight loss, decreased immunity and so on. [0003] Studies have shown that microorganisms mutate within a few days in an environment without gravity. Some bacteria have altered gene expression pathways and the bacteria become more virulent.
